Hi Everyone.

I have been playing with a script to effectively write my own PAN user agent for a rather specific reason.

I can confirm that my script generates a valid xml script and I can post it via the api browser and see that the IP address and new username correlate.

The bit where I get stuck is getting cURL to post the the xml file to the api. I am using the following command:

curl --insecure --form file=@output.xml "https://192.168.1.1/api/?type=user-id&action=set&key=INSERT-KEY-HERE"

and receive the following error back:

<response status = 'error' code = '400'><result><msg>No file uploaded</msg></result></response>

any help would be much appreciated thanks!

also, when I try this:

wget --no-check-certificate --post-file output.xml "https://192.168.1.1/api/?type=user-id&action=set&client=wget&file-name=output.xml"

the file is processed by the api and I can see the user to ip mapping, however wget continues to retry the command as it is expecting a response

The behavior you are seeing with cURL is a known issue which has been fixed and is currently targeted to be included in PAN-OS 5.0.4.  The open bug number is 48966.

Just out of curiosity what's the fix? Is it to respond with an HTTP status code after the POST succeeds?

I don't have much detail, but it is related to some validation checks being applied incorrectly when cURL was used.  Due to the failed check the device would ignore the uploaded file and not create a user mapping based on the file.
